32 /*
33  * Simplified version of malloc(), calloc() and free(), to be linked with
34  * utilities that use [s]brk() and do not define their own version of the
35  * routines.
36  * The algorithm maps /dev/zero to get extra memory space.
37  * Each call to mmap() creates a page. The pages are linked in a list.
38  * Each page is divided in blocks. There is at least one block in a page.
39  * New memory chunks are allocated on a first-fit basis.
40  * Freed blocks are joined in larger blocks. Free pages are unmapped.
41  */

268 	/*
269 	 * Add the free block to the free APlist for later defragmentation.
270 	 * However, this addition can only be achieved if there is room on the
271 	 * free APlist.  The APlist can't be allowed to grow, as the growth
272 	 * requires a realloc(), which would recurse back here, resulting in an
273 	 * infinite loop.  If the free APlist is full, defrag() now.  This
274 	 * defragmentation might not be able to collapse any free space, but
275 	 * the free APlist will be cleared as part of the processing, ensuring
276 	 * room for the addition.
277 	 */
